The products are sterile with a Sterility Assurance Level (SAL) of 10-6, non-pyrogenic and single-use devices. The products has several models. Different models are distinguished by needle gauge and length.The Safety Pen Needle consists of needle tube, needle shield, spring, housing, needle hub, needle container, UV glue and silicone oil. UV glue is used to glue needle tube and needle hub and the silicone oil is used to needle tube lubrication.The product is designed to reduce occurrence of accidental needle sticks from patient end of the needle byproviding a shield that covers and locks the needle after use. As the user proceeds with inserting theneedle into the skin the shield will retract. After the injection is completed and needle is removedfrom the skin, the shield will automatically extend to cover the needle and lock in place. Once theSafety Type Insulin Pen Needle is in the locked mode, it can no longer be used.The products are for OTC use, and they are external communication, blood indirect devices. The contact duration for both subjecteddevices is within 24h, and they belong to limited contact device according ISO 10993-1.
A device designed for the parenteral administration of a drug contained in a cartridge that forms part of, is attached to, or inserted into an autoinjector (drug pen injector). It is used by persons requiring regular, self-administrated dosages of insulin, hormones, or other pharmaceuticals. This device will typically be constructed as a double-ended, stainless steel needle of various sizes that is fixed to a threaded hub of plastic to which the drug pen injector is connected. This device is packaged in a sealed sterility barrier, and might include needle shielding safety features to reduce the risk of needle stick injury. This is a single-use device.
